IMDb Rating: 6.0/10
Genre: Action, Comedy, Sci-Fi
Director: Jon McDonald
Released Date: 10 March 2022
Stars Cast: Cary Elwes, Penelope Mitchell, Elaine Tan
Storyline: In 1960, Professor Ruckus invented the Titan badge – a device that enables humans to have a particular superpower. Cut to 1979 when two of the original superheroes are all grown up and want their Titan badges back.
You may also like